Some poking around with SQLite Manager shows they are still listed in moz_places table in places.sqlite - it's the moz_bookmarks table got reset to default.
Oddly, keyword entry still works. Not only that, when the keyword is typed in full, the site for the keyword is offered in the dropdown that comes up, along with its favicon. That's despite having history already cleared and not visiting the site since.
Is this a known bug? How to prevent my bookmarks being half-eaten?
